Data from ancient times

Medu netjer is what the Egyptians called their hieroglyphs, ‘divine words’. They were convinced that the hieroglyphs in temples and tombs contained divine wisdom. Thoth, the god of wisdom, is said to have given them writing. Through writing, they were able to preserve their knowledge for later generations. But the deeper knowledge from ancient Egypt lies beyond words, hidden in stone, shrouded in myths and symbols. And yet, the hieroglyphs themselves sometimes contain deeper knowledge.
